Hello,

I have a set of OZ Superleggra alloy wheels in anthracite (dark grey) for sale. They are in really good condition and have Goodyear eagle F1's all round with a very good amount of tread left on them!!

I bought these wheels from a guy on here about a year ago, i have recently sold my S2000 therefore i now need to sell these.

There is some kerbing on the edge of the back wheels, and one back wheel has a slight dent in the outer rim - this was the mrs's fault!!!!! These wheels look great on the S2000 - and have always been my favourite type of aftermarket wheels.

The handling with these wheels and tyres was by far better than the standard 16" wheels- i only really noticed this when i put the old wheels back on.

The tyres are GSD3's on the front with roughly 5mm tread and the rears are the asymmetric pattern with about 5mm left as well.
